Chain/C-Store $45k – United Distributors
The Off Premise Sales Apprentice role is an entry‑level position into our sales organization that allows an associate to prepare for a Sales Representative role position involves running vacation routes for Sales Representatives, performing sales deliveries to accounts, merchandising and building displays in accounts, managing and rotating inventory in accounts, and building relationships with both accounts and various departments of United.
This position is perfect for a self‑motivated, competitive individual who thrives in situations requiring a high level of collaboration, organization, interpersonal skills, and creativity.
